Unicorn Legend is the 4th edition of the Unicorn keyboard. It is designed by one of the founding members of kbdlab.co.kr
It features a 2 piece aluminum housing, with an acrylic diffuser.

(The PCB shown with a breakaway numpad is not for this keyboard. It's for a separate project...)

no word yet on pricing, and the earliest the groupbuy would open is end of April or early May. However, it will be limited to about ~40 units and only available in Korea  :eek:  :))

Post by: Vloshko on Mon, 08 January 2018, 22:32:58
For some reason unknown to me, when right clicking on Snow_CDC_Driver.inf to install, it wouldn't do anything at all.
In case anyone ever needs the solution to the problem I had:
Going into Device Manager to manually upload Snow_CDC_Driver.inf to the board worked. It now connects to Snow Tools.
